Abstract

A sealed electron beam source () for an imaging tube () is provided. The beam source () includes a source housing () with a source window () having a first voltage potential and a source electrode () having a second voltage potential. The source electrode () generates electrons and emits the electrons through the source window () to a target () that is external to the source housing (). A method of supplying and directing electrons on the target () within the imaging tube () is also provided. The method includes forming the source housing () over the source electrode () and sealing the source housing (). The electrons are generated and emitted from the source electrode () and directed through the source window () to the target ().
